Abstract

The invention discloses an automatic checking and early warning method and device for a microorganism drug sensitivity test and a readable storage medium. The method comprises the steps that a preliminary microorganism detection result is obtained to determine to-be-tested microorganisms, a to-be-tested drug sensitivity combination is determined according to the names of the to-be-tested microorganisms, and if a drug test result of one or more microorganisms in the to-be-tested drug sensitivity combination is drug-resistant or intermediary, the to-be-tested microorganisms have drug resistanceto the to-be-tested drug sensitivity combination. By means of the automatic checking and early warning method and device for the microorganism drug sensitivity test and the readable storage medium, the preliminary microorganism detection result is obtained, the result is further analyzed, the drug sensitivity checking step of the to-be-tested microorganisms is determined, the requirement of microorganism detection for the drug sensitivity test is met, and automatic checking of the microorganisms is achieved.

Description

technical field [0001] The invention relates to the field of microbial detection, in particular to an automatic review and early warning method, device and computer-readable storage medium for microbial drug susceptibility testing. Background technique [0002] Nowadays, due to the wide application of various antibacterial drugs, the number of drug-resistant strains has increased rapidly, especially the uncontrolled use of broad-spectrum and ultra-broad-spectrum antibacterial drugs, resulting in the emergence of a large number of drug-resistant mutants. Empirical medication thus increases the failure rate; some severe infections, such as brain abscess, sepsis, abdominal abscess, etc., may cause drug poisoning due to antibacterial drug dose treatment. Therefore, an important task of clinical microbiology is to conduct antimicrobial susceptibility tests on isolated pathogenic bacteria.
